Many of us came to admire & respect Khalsa Aid, a Sikh humanitarian aid group, when they set up food stations for Rohingya refugees at Cox’s Bazar in Bangladesh in 2017. There are a lot of photos of them cooking & serving food. Now we hear that Khalsa Aid provided an ambulance to the family of Aashiq Hussain, a Kashmiri killed in a road accident in India, so they could transport him home for burial. In the midst of all this misery, they are a source of pride in our humanity.

This photo is one of my Facebook friends who was shot with pellets several weeks ago while visiting his family in Kashmir. Consider the state of healthcare under India’s siege & blockade so that those now pummeled with lead pellets are unable to get treated at hospital or are fearful of going for treatment lest they be arrested as ‘miscreants’ or stone pelters. Many victims are working class kids whose pellet injuries require specialized medical care & are unable to afford it.
